Pair of Chinese Export Porcelain Bough Pots, first quarter 19th century, the turquoise grounds decorated with flower trellises, the sides with panels of Mandarin figures and baskets of flowers under the handles, drilled for lamps, h. 10", w. 9", d. 9".


  • Condition: In overall very good condition. There is a chip to one foot rim that has been inpainted. There are also some scattered small losses to pigment, notably to the rims and edges.
